Jet dispensing of anaerobic adhesives and threadlockers

2 May 2013 adhesives

Non-contact, jet dispensing technology from Liquidyn is an process enabler; precision amounts of liquids like oils, adhesives, greases and coatings can be applied accurately and fast. Now, even challenging materials like anaerobic adhesives (threadlockers, thread sealants, retaining materials and flange sealants) can use this methodology. High temperature resistant polyimide adhesives

25 February 2013 adhesives

The Polytec PT range of state-of-the-art polyimide adhesives provide excellent thermal resistance, superior to other typical organic adhesives. They are characterised as modified polyimide single component solvent containing adhesives and coatings which are applicable in the temperature range from 240°C to 500°C.
